At HPE we believe in being a force for good, striving to make a positive impact in South Africa. We know that technology can drive better solutions and are committed to assisting charitable organisations in the ICT sector in line with the Broad-Based Black Economic Empowerment (BBBEE) Act.

We would like to invite you to participate in our Socio-Economic Development Programme for 2026.

This programme provides grants and donations to advance ICT schemes in South Africa, forming part of HPE’s commitment in promoting the legislative requirements of the BBBEE Act. Recently, the Socio-Economic Development Programme has enabled organisations to offer education programmes for youth and adults as well as providing IT equipment for charities including the Nelson Mandela Children’s Hospital in Johannesburg.
